Output eae4881ab5a66a98fbafcb3820e73e888945795893cdd5e36d2b81e77cc1979d:4

value
127118489
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50ae4e4107b1dd0b64a425c0d27360e60cd26b98 OP_EQUAL
address
393cnru82espwnyrweHktU83etCRB1B7fC
transaction
eae4881ab5a66a98fbafcb3820e73e888945795893cdd5e36d2b81e77cc1979d
spent
true